His Highness the Aga Khan IV, 1936-2025

His Highness Prince Karim Al-Hussaini, Aga Khan IV, 49th hereditary Imam of the Shia Ismaili Muslims and descendant of the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him), passed away peacefully in Lisbon on 4 February 2025, aged 88, surrounded by his family.

The announcement of his designated successor will follow.

Aga Khan IV established the Aga Khan Foundation in 1967 to bring together human, financial and technical resources to address the challenges faced by the poorest and most marginalised communities in the world. The Foundation operates in 18 countries across Africa, Asia, Europe, the Middle East and North America.

The management, staff and volunteers of the Aga Khan Foundation offer our condolences to the family of His Highness and to the Ismaili community worldwide. As we honour the legacy of our founder, Prince Karim Aga Khan, we continue to work with our partners to improve the quality of life for individuals and communities across the world.
